Output 62a266ba02295d2a687ab6efb30fe8e106cba0b132d5b8d80644c1b4feefad85:0

value
3803429053
script pubkey
OP_0 OP_PUSHBYTES_20 d9460e5a454f7b2424dfbf5ed824820925ee2b25
address
tb1qm9rqukj9faajgfxlha0dsfyzpyj7u2e94ncuq7
transaction
62a266ba02295d2a687ab6efb30fe8e106cba0b132d5b8d80644c1b4feefad85